hemp building panels are made from the fibers of the industrial hemp plant, which is a strain of the Cannabis sativa plant. Hemp has been used for centuries for various purposes, including textiles, paper, and food, but its use in construction is relatively new. The fibers of the hemp plant are incredibly strong and durable, making them an ideal material for building panels. These panels are typically made by compressing the hemp fibers together with a binding agent to create a solid and sturdy panel that can be used in a variety of construction projects.
One of the key advantages of hemp building panels is their sustainability. Hemp is a fast-growing plant that requires minimal water and no pesticides to grow, making it an environmentally friendly option for construction materials. Additionally, hemp building panels are biodegradable and do not emit harmful chemicals or toxins, making them a safe and eco-friendly choice for building projects. By using hemp building panels, builders can reduce their carbon footprint and contribute to a more sustainable future.
Another benefit of hemp building panels is their insulating properties. Hemp fibers are naturally insulating, meaning that buildings constructed with hemp panels can be more energy-efficient and cost-effective to heat and cool. The insulating properties of hemp panels can help reduce energy bills and create a more comfortable living or working environment for occupants. Additionally, hemp panels have excellent soundproofing qualities, making them an ideal choice for buildings in noisy or urban environments.
In addition to being sustainable and insulating, hemp building panels are also incredibly strong and durable. Hemp fibers are known for their strength, and when compressed into panels, they create a robust and long-lasting building material. Hemp panels are resistant to rot, mold, and pests, making them a low-maintenance option for builders. This durability means that buildings constructed with hemp panels can have a longer lifespan and require fewer repairs and replacements over time.
